In 2021, Slintecare Healthy Ireland in the Department of Health, working with the HSE and local authorities and community agencies, launched the Slintecare Healthy Communities Programme to provide increased health and wellbeing services in 19 community areas across Ireland.
The standards are grouped according to 8 themes as follows: n person-centred care and support n effective care and support n safe care and support n better health and wellbeing n leadership, governance and management n workforce n use of resources n use of information.
Standards are explicit statements of expected quality in the performance of a health care activity. They may take the form of procedures, clinical practice guidelines, treatment protocols, critical paths, algorithms, standard operating procedures, or statements of expected health care outcomes, among other formats.

The HSEs Enhanced Community Care (ECC) programme is enhancing and increasing community health services and reducing pressure on hospital services. This means more services closer to where people live. Especially for older people and people with chronic disease.
What is Slintecare? Put simply, Slintecare is the name for the initiative to reform Irelands healthcare to move away from a two-tier system and towards a system based on medical need.

Reporting to the Minister for Health and engaging with the Minister for Children, Equality, Disability, Integration and Youth Affairs, HIQAs role is to develop standards, inspect and review health and social care services and support informed decisions on how services are delivered.
